A woman has sustained serious injuries after she fell into a fire pit on the Sunshine Coast.

The woman in her 70s suffered severe burns to her back and abdomen in the incident on a private property on Christmas Day.

The woman was treated on scene by Queensland Ambulance Service (QAS) paramedics.

A Sunshine Coast LifeFlight helicopter was tasked to the area at 3.35pm and landed at a school oval.

Paramedics transported her to the helicopter, where she received further treatment from the LifeFlight critical care doctor and QAS flight paramedic.

The patient was then airlifted to Royal Brisbane and Women’s Hospital for further treatment.
